In general, every person has chakra that has an affinity towards one of the elements or elements, a characteristic that seems to be genetic, since whole clans sometimes share the same affinity. To find out what affinity someone has, pieces of paper made from a special type of tree, that was made to absorb chakra, are used that react to even the slightest hint of chakra in any of a number of ways, depending on the nature latent in the chakra. If one has wind nature, it would split in two. If one has fire nature, it would ignite and turn to ash. If one has lightning nature, it would wrinkle. If one has earth nature ,it would turn to dirt and go away with the wind, and if one has water nature, it would become wet. This all makes it easier to learn how to create and control the nature, although even with an affinity this process will usually take any number of years. Shinobi are not limited to the nature they have an affinity to though, because by the time they reach the rank of Jōnin, most shinobi have mastered two natures. Because of the difficulty of mastering a nature and the time required to learn it, it is almost impossible for any one person to master all five natures through natural methods.
